docs(contribute): replace Azure DevOps references with GitHub equivalents#198
docs(contribute): replace Azure DevOps references with GitHub equivalents#198Dejmenek wants to merge 6 commits intomicrosoft:mainfrom
Conversation
|
@microsoft-github-policy-service agree |
There was a problem hiding this comment.
Pull request overview
This PR migrates CONTRIBUTING.md from Azure DevOps references to GitHub-native equivalents, addressing issue #194. The changes replace 7 internal Azure DevOps organization URLs with publicly accessible GitHub URLs and update ADO-specific workflow language to use GitHub terminology and conventions.
Changes:
- Replaced all Azure DevOps organization URLs (
dev.azure.com) with GitHub repository URLs - Updated tracking system references from "Azure DevOps issues/Features" to "GitHub Issues"
- Removed "internal Stack Overflow" reference to reflect OSS project status
- Fixed documentation paths for MegaLinter and Coding Conventions guides
| - Make sure that you are using the latest version. | ||
| - Read the [documentation](./docs/README.md) carefully and find out if the functionality is already covered, maybe by an individual configuration. | ||
| - Perform a [search](https://dev.azure.com/ai-at-the-edge-flagship-accelerator/IaC%20for%20the%20Edge/_workitems/) to see if the enhancement has already been suggested. If it has, add a comment to the existing workitem instead of opening a new one. | ||
| - Perform a [search](https://github.com/microsoft/edge-ai/issues) to see if the enhancement has already been suggested. If it has, add a comment to the existing workitem instead of opening a new one. |
There was a problem hiding this comment.
The term "workitem" is Azure DevOps-specific terminology. For consistency with the GitHub migration, this should be changed to "issue" to match GitHub's terminology. The sentence should read "add a comment to the existing issue instead of opening a new one."
CONTRIBUTING.md
Outdated
| - Commits (or at least one in a commit chain) should reference a User Story or Task item from the backlog for traceability. | ||
| - When creating a PR, ensure descriptions use [Azure DevOps notation to close associated work items](https://learn.microsoft.com/azure/devops/repos/git/resolution-mentions?view=azure-devops). | ||
| - Assign the GitHub Issue to yourself before beginning any effort, and set the item's status field accordingly. | ||
| - If a work item for your contribution does not exist, [please file an issue](https://github.com/microsoft/edge-ai/issues/new/choose) first to engage the project's PO, TPM, or Tech Lead for guidance. |
There was a problem hiding this comment.
The term "work item" is Azure DevOps-specific terminology. For consistency with the GitHub migration, this should be changed to "GitHub issue" or simply "issue" to match GitHub's terminology. The sentence should read "If a GitHub issue for your contribution does not exist" or "If an issue for your contribution does not exist".
| - If a work item for your contribution does not exist, [please file an issue](https://github.com/microsoft/edge-ai/issues/new/choose) first to engage the project's PO, TPM, or Tech Lead for guidance. | |
| - If a GitHub issue for your contribution does not exist, [please file an issue](https://github.com/microsoft/edge-ai/issues/new/choose) first to engage the project's PO, TPM, or Tech Lead for guidance. |
Pull Request
Description
I replaced Azure DevOps organization URLs with GitHub-native equivalents, fixed broken links for MegaLinter and Coding Conventions, rewrote ADO workflow language for GitHub-native workflows and removed the "internal Stack Overflow" reference.
Related Issue
Closes #194
Type of Change
Testing Performed